The SBI PO exam is conducted once every year for recruiting candidates for the post of Probationary Officer. There are around 2000 vacancies that will be available for the post of PO in 2020. As SBI is one of the leading banks in India, there will be a lot of aspirants that will prepare for this exam. Thus the competition will be very high. 

To crack the SBI PO exams the candidates must have a complete understanding of the syllabus and all the topics that will come in the exam. The topics that will be covered in the SBI PO 2020 exam will consist of Analytical Reasoning, Aptitude, General Awareness, and General English. It is mandatory for the candidates that they are aware of the best about the best SBI PO Books for good practice. 

SBI PO Cut Off

The SBI PO aspirants will have to go through a fixed selection process that consists of three stages (Prelims, Mains, and Interview/Group exercise). Before you start with the exam preparation, you can have a look at the previous years' SBI PO Cut Off to get an idea of how much you will have to score to secure your PO post spot in SBI. The cut off for the current year is released soon after the results are declared, but it usually is near the previous years cut off. So you can prepare for the exam while keeping in mind the previous years cut off. 

Various factors affect the cut-off. The most important factors are the candidate's performance in the exam, the total number of applicants, total vacancies, and the trend of previous years cut off.

Preparation Tactics to be Exam Ready for SBI PO

Even if you have the best books with the best information needed to crack the exam, you will not do well in the exam if you don’t use them well. Firstly, start working on a timetable that is realistic and is as per your learning pace. Calculate all the variables like the time remaining for the exam, the syllabus, your learning pace, your focus hours, and everything else. Do not get intimidated by others who seem to be ahead of you, and start copying everything they do. You must realize that everyone is unique, so make a time table for yourself that suits you the best. Once you are done with preparing a timetable make sure you stick to it. Be consistent and disciplined. 

Make sure you follow these steps too while preparing for the SBI PO exam – 

Learn all the basic concepts and the important concepts

Students tend to use shortcuts on solving questions and sometimes ignore the concept behind it. This can backfire in the exam and can reduce your score drastically. Make sure that you study all the concepts to the root. If you ever face a complex concept based question, then you will not find it difficult to solve.

                                                            Do you want help in your SAT/ACT Preparation?

Recognize your weak points and work on them

There will be some topics that you might find difficult and make the majority of the mistakes. You must know which topics are like these that you find difficult, then you must start to focus on them accordingly. The best way to analyze your preparation and know your weak area is to solve mock tests. 

Solve mock tests and previous year papers

As said in the previous point, mock tests can help you to recognize your weak areas. But mock tests can help you with a lot of other things to boost your exam preparation. You get to practice on questions of various formats, you know exactly where you make the most mistakes in, you get a sense of time management. So you must include mock tests in your preparation without fail.
